Baverstocks Commercial Hotel existed from at least 1871. By 1905 this was trading as the Aldgate Hotel. By 1927 it had been renamed the Hotel Central and traded under that name until around 1940. The pub/hotel is now closed and the premises are in mixed commercial use. ** "The area around Aldgate was known as 'Little Germany' and was for much of the 19th century the largest concentration of German-speaking people outside the German homelands. Sometime prior to the April 1891 census, these premises were taken over by German-born Joseph Wesl and family, who converted the rooms into a hotel and pub. Next door, at no. 78, was another pub, the Rose & Crown, headed by Richard Milchard in 1888. Milchard was followed by Mrs Jane Vancolle in 1889, and in 1890, the 33-year-old, London-born, Woolf Hart had assumed proprietorship of this establishment" *
